Chamaecrista fasciculata aka Partridge Pea

Taxonomy ID: 13317

Common names

Partridge Pea, Golden Cassia, Sensitive Pea

What is the growth pattern and size of Partridge Pea?

Partridge Pea grows vertically and new growth emerges from the top of the plant.

What is the region of origin of Partridge Pea

Partridge Pea’s native range is Eastern, Central and South-eastern N. America.
